Alonso: Age doesn't slow F1 drivers

As one of the elder statesmen on the grid, Fernando Alonso feels Formula 1 drivers don't slow with age as the sport is largely about 'the car.' Alonso will celebrate his 36th birthday next season as he lines up on the grid in what will be his 16th season in Formula 1. The double World Champion is still rated by many are one of the best on the grid but it remains to be seen whether he will extend his McLaren stay beyond 2017. However, when the time does come to hang up his helmet, he says it will be because of he is tired of the life and not because age has slowed him down.
